Italy has one of the highest percentages of overweight children in the world, so it would seem the Mediterranean diet, is slowly becoming a thing of the past.

Most of the chubby children seem to be concentrated in the south of the country, for exactly the reason Amalfimamma cites, the nonna feeders with huge plates of pasta and ragù. Up north (from anecdata based on DD's peers, friends and family/families of friends) most children are what I would call regular sized and there seem to be fewer overweight kids, maybe one or two per school year. When we go to the UK or to the southern Italy DD gets tutted at for being too skinny, which she's not.

By the way, the biscuits in the bottle thing appears to be another southern Italian thing. We get warned against it because of the risks but down south it seems to be encouraged by the pediatri.
